TuttleOFX is an open source image sequences processing framework made up of :
- a set of plugins to read and write professional VFX image formats and to perform various image processings (color corrections, filters, video compression, ...)
- a set of command line tools called Sam to browse, copy, move, delete and batch process the aforementioned plugins.
OpenFX Architecture
The aim of TuttleOFX is to help post-production facilities to deal with large-scale everyday image processing tasks. Compared with other programming libraries and image processing tools, TuttleOFX is based on some extended OpenFX plugins architecture, combined with optimised selection bit-depth processing.
Support For Numerous Processes
In addition of standard process features, TuttleOFX also addresses requested VFX processes like lens-distort corrections or movie compression and even some more specific color treatments like Color Transform Language and OpenColorIO nodes.
Support For 3rd Party Applications
Thanks to their OpenFX nature, TuttleOFX plugins can be used either in the Sam command line tool or by other applications such as Nuke® (The Foundry), Scratch® (Assimilate), Baselight® (FilmLight), Mistika® (SGO). Similarly, commercial OpenFX plugins (Sapphire, Furnace, Keylight, ...) can be used within Sam command line.